Praying Scripture: For Children

​God responds to your prayers as a mother or father. He hears your cries for the safety, wisdom and direction of your children. Be led in prayer by God's voice through Scripture. Let your prayers for your children be power-packed. Use the following Scriptures below for new effectiveness in prayer. 

For Hunger for God's Word
Joshua 1:8 - Do not let this Book of the Law depart from your mouth; meditate on it day and night, so that you may be careful to do everything written in it. Then you will be prosperous and successful.

Pray: Dear Lord, I pray that (child's name) will hunger for Your Word... that it will fill his/her life. Let (child's name) live a prosperous life built on the foundation of the Bible.

For Courage
Joshua 1:9 - Have I not commanded you? Be strong and courageous. Do not be terrified; do not be discouraged, for the Lord your God will be with you wherever you go.

Pray: Father, fill (child's name) with courage today to obey everything that You have said. Do not let him/her fall into anxiety and fear.

For Protection
Psalm 91:9-12 - If you make the Most High your dwelling–even the Lord, who is my refuge– then no harm will befall you, no disaster will come near your tent. For he will command his angels concerning you to guard you in all your ways; they will lift you up in their hands, so that you will not strike your foot against a stone.

Pray: Father, I pray protection over (child's name). Let him/her stay within Your boundaries and know true safety. Surround him/her with Your angels today. In Jesus' name, Amen.

For Unborn Children
Psalm 139:13-16 - For you created my inmost being; you knit me together in my mother’s womb. I praise you because I am fearfully and wonderfully made; your works are wonderful, I know that full well. My frame was not hidden from you when I was made in the secret place. When I was woven together in the depths of the earth, your eyes saw my unformed body. All the days ordained for me were written in your book before one of them came to be.

Pray: Dear Father, You see what people cannot see. You are knitting this little one together in the unseen places. Thank for your detailed involvement. Continue Your work of creation in the secret place. I trust You.

For Submission to God's Way
Proverbs 4:10-13 -  Listen, my son, accept what I say, and the years of your life will be many. I guide you in the way of wisdom and lead you along straight paths. When you walk, your steps will not be hampered; when you run, you will not stumble. Hold on to instruction, do not let it go; guard it well, for it is your life.

Pray: Father, draw (child's name) into deep submission to You and Your ways. Let (child's name) hunger to hear You and obey You above all else. Thank You for being the best Father. Amen.

For Purity
Proverbs 4:23-26 - Above all else, guard your heart, for it is the wellspring of life. Put away perversity from your mouth; keep corrupt talk far from your lips. Let your eyes look straight ahead, fix your gaze directly before you. Make level paths for your feet and take only ways that are firm.

Pray: Dear Father, I pray the protection of Your purity over (child's name). Let (child's name) make right choices in guarding their own purity of heart, what they say, what they look at and where they go.

For a Godly Spouse
Proverbs 31:10 - A wife of noble character who can find? She is worth far more than rubies.

Pray: Dear Father, I pray that you would find the right spouse for (child's name)... that this person would have noble character... that You would protect this spouse even now and develop within them a great desire for You.

For a Life of Fulfillment through Hearing God's Voice
Isaiah 55:2-3 - Why spend money on what is not bread, and your labor on what does not satisfy? Listen, listen to me, and eat what is good, and your soul will delight in the richest of fare. Give ear and come to me; hear me, that your soul may live.

Pray: Dear Lord, open up (child's name) to hear Your voice. Bring a hunger in his/her heart to know You and the fulfillment that You bring.

For Filling of the Holy Spirit
Acts 2:38-39 - Peter replied, “Repent and be baptized, every one of you, in the name of Jesus Christ for the forgiveness of your sins. And you will receive the gift of the Holy Spirit. The promise is for you and your children and for all who are far off–for all whom the Lord our God will call.

Pray: Let (child's name) obey Your command to walk in repentance. I believe in Your promise that my son/daughter will receive the gift of Your Holy Spirit. Pour Yourself on them.

For Hope
Romans 15:13 - May the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ace as you trust in him, so that you may overflow with hope by the power of the Holy Spirit.

Pray: Oh God, You are the God of hope. Fill (child's name) with Your overflowing hope today. Let your power flow so that he/she can experience this hope.

For Wisdom and Revelation
Ephesians 1:17-19 - I keep asking that the God of our Lord Jesus Christ, the glorious Father, may give you the Spirit of wisdom and revelation, so that you may know him better. I pray also that the eyes of your heart may be enlightened in order that you may know the hope to which he has called you, the riches of his glorious inheritance in the saints, and his incomparably great power for us who believe.

Pray: Dear Jesus, give (child’s name) your Spirit of wisdom and revelation. Help him to know You so much better. Open his eyes to see You. Open his spirit to understand You and really desire You.

For Direction
Ephesians 2:10 - For we are God’s workmanship, created in Christ Jesus to do good works, which God prepared in advance for us to do.

Pray: Dear Father, (child’s name) is your workmanship. Thank you that you have already planned good works for him to step into. Let him see what you are doing and walk with you.

For Exposure of Sin
Ephesians 5:11-13 - Have nothing to do with the fruitless deeds of darkness, but rather expose them. For it is shameful even to mention what the disobedient do in secret. But everything exposed by the light becomes visible.

Pray: Heavenly Father, if there is any darkness that (child's name) is walking in, please expose it. Let Your light shine and bring conviction of sin wherever it is needed.

For Submission to Parents
Ephesians 6:1-3 - ​ Children, obey your parents in the Lord, for this is right. “Honor your father and mother”–which is the first commandment with a promise– “that it may go well with you and that you may enjoy long life on the earth.

Pray: Dear Lord, I pray that (child's name) will grow in heart submission to us as his/her parents. I pray for a softness and tenderness toward us. Grant (child's name) a long life of enjoying the rewards of honor and submission. Amen.

For Completion of God's Work
Philippians 1:6 - ...being confident of this, that he who began a good work in you will carry it on to completion until the day of Christ Jesus.

Pray: Father, I hold onto Your promise that You will complete what You have started in (child's name).

For Discernment
Philippians 1:9-11 - And this is my prayer: that your love may abound more and more in knowledge and depth of insight, so that you may be able to discern what is best and may be pure and blameless until the day of Christ, filled with the fruit of righteousness that comes through Jesus Christ–to the glory and praise of God.

Pray: Dear Father, let your love grow in (child’s name). Give him increasing revelation. Help him to discern Your best for every aspect of his life. Help him to keep growing and persevere until Jesus comes back.

To be a Light in the Darkness
Philippians 2:15 - ...so that you may become blameless and pure, children of God without fault in a crooked and depraved generation, in which you shine like stars in the universe.

Pray: Father, let (child's name) become like a shining star in this dark world. Help them to escape the corruption of this world and walk in purity before You.

For Blamelessness
1 Thessalonians 5:23-24 - May God himself, the God of peace, sanctify you through and through. May your whole spirit, soul and body be kept blameless at the coming of our Lord Jesus Christ. The one who calls you is faithful and he will do it.

Pray: Father God, I pray that (child's name) will be kept blameless in body, mind, spirit and soul all the way until Jesus comes again. I depend on your promises. You are the faithful One who will secure my children forever.
